Summary

Cloudflare has announced its support for Apple's Private Attestation Tokens (PAT) in its Cloudflare Access service. This feature allows security teams to verify a user's Apple device before they access sensitive applications, without the need to install any additional software or collect device data. PAT leverages the Privacy Pass Protocol and requires four parties to work together: an Origin, a Client, an Attester, and an Issuer. Cloudflare Access will support verifying if a user is accessing from a "healthy" Apple device before allowing access to sensitive corporate applications. The company plans to expand device support and verification attributes over time.
